
牛客算法视频
文章平均质量分 73
xtiange
这个人很懒,什么也没有留下。
展开
-
小和问题
Java实现public class smallSum { public static int samllSumCount(int[] arr){ if (arr == null || arr.length <2){ return 0; } return mergeSort(arr, 0, arr.length...原创 2018-06-26 16:16:37 · 2141 阅读 · 1 评论 -
按照一个数的大小分裂数组,以及荷兰国旗问题
给定一个数组arr, 和一个数num, 请把小于等于num的数放在数组的左边, 大于num的数放在数组的右边。要求额外空间复杂度O(1), 时间复杂度O(N)。Python代码def split_array(arr, num): """维持一个小于等于区域的index, 如果一个数小于等于num,则和index位置交换 如果一个数大于num,则直接跳下一个 """...原创 2018-06-26 20:34:23 · 505 阅读 · 0 评论